Nigerian sensation Omah Lay has revealed a highly anticipated collaboration with Afrobeats superstar Davido.

Speaking with hosts Ferrari Simmons and Byron Turner on The Baller Alert Show, the 27-year-old artist shared his enthusiasm for the upcoming release.

Omah Lay expressed his surprise at how seamlessly they connected during their collaboration. “We have a song already that’s coming out, and I’m so excited about it!”

The singer, whose real name is Stanley Omah Didi, admitted that he started the project with modest expectations. However, Davido’s warm demeanor transformed his outlook, leading to a fruitful partnership. “The way we got along, and how we made this record happen, blew my mind,” he added.

Lay, who previously believed that Davido had a negative view of him, now describes the ‘Assurance’ hitmaker as an “amazing person.” He expressed his astonishment at how effortlessly they collaborated.

Omah Lay also touched on the dynamics within the Nigerian music scene, dispelling the myth that all artists are close friends. “There’s a lot of love, but also competition, and that’s what makes the industry thrive,” he noted. “When everyone is relaxed, it doesn’t drive innovation. But we’re not at odds; it’s healthy competition. I just want to make better music and be the best.”

Omah Lay has become a standout figure in the Nigerian music landscape. He first captured attention in 2020 with hit singles “You” and “Bad Influence,” showcasing his unique style and talent.
